Parks Associates and EH Publishing Join Forces to Monitor Home Systems Integration/Installation Channels

March 7, 2007, Orlando, Fl — Parks Associates and EH Publishing today announced a research alliance that combines their expertise in the home systems integration space to provide high-level data and analysis on the players, market dynamics, and future trends for this rapidly expanding channel. Current growth in the home systems integration/custom installation channel will push U.S. residential sales revenues to nearly $10 billion in 2007, due in large part to expanding business models and more affordable technologies, according to Parks Associates.

“Low-voltage specialists are branching out from their traditional, very wealthy clientele,” said Bill Ablondi, director of home systems research for Parks Associates. “At the same time, other trades are acquiring the necessary skills to install home systems, and IT specialists are entering the industry to capitalize on opportunities based on IP technology. As you add in the potential revenues from firms serving markets further down the pyramid, not only does the diversity increase, but so too does the volume.”

In this new research alliance, Parks Associates and EH Publishing will both contribute expertise and survey data into a series of jointly authored research projects, providing clients with in-depth coverage of the home systems integration space.

“Monitoring this channel activity requires a unique breadth of resources and skills,” said Daryl Delano, director of research for EH Publishing. “EH Publishing and Parks Associates together are in the unique position to not only monitor the channels but influence their growth by helping companies capitalize on advancements in technology, changes in consumer requirements, and the emergence of completely new opportunities.”

Parks Associates has been deeply involved with all aspects of the market for digital systems and services for more than 20 years. “One question we are hearing is ‘Why is the market expanding now?'” said Tricia Parks, founder and CEO of Parks Associates. “Consumers are ready, affordable systems are available, and broadband adoption has created the necessary infrastructure for adoption of home systems that, just a few years ago, only the top 2-3 percent of American households could afford.”
